1.Wash the car to be polished (partial polishing, you can only clean the area that needs polishing).
2.If you want to remove deep scratches, first use 1500# sandpaper for sanding. When you finish sanding the sandpaper, you should clean the dust from the sandpaper with water or a wet towel. Do not let the dust remain on the paint surface.
3.Spread the wax evenly with a sponge on the paint surface that needs to be waxed (if the whole car is waxed, it should be done locally. It is absolutely not allowed to first apply the whole car before waxing, because the inside of the wax is operated like this The solvent will evaporate, and there will be a lot of dust when waxing, and it will cause the phenomenon of burning paint).
4.Use a polishing machine with a spherical medium sponge disc (ordinary flat sponges are also available, and woolen balls or rabbit hair balls can also be used for construction. The surface of the sponge balls must be clean, and no other waxes or other substances can stick to it. On it).
5.First run the polisher at low speed for 600 rpm to completely push the wax away, go back and forth several times and then increase the gear, the speed is increased to 1400 rpm. The fastest speed is recommended to collect wax within 2200 rpm.
6.Until all the wax is collected, the brightness is improved, and the scratches are smoothed, the next partial area construction can be carried out.
7.After the construction of the whole vehicle by analogy is completed, it is recommended to clean it.
